Brian Beard is in his second season as an assistant coach with the Norfolk State baseball program. He coaches the outfielders in addition to assisting with hitting instruction. Beard also serves as the program’s camp coordinator and assists with recruiting.
Beard was a two-year letterman for the Spartans from 2016-17. He played all over the diamond, starting games at all three outfield positions, first base, second and third bases, and pitcher. In two seasons after transferring from Old Dominion, Beard batted .316 as a Spartan with 22 doubles, 69 runs scored, 50 RBIs and 37 stolen bases while helping the Spartans win a pair of MEAC Northern Division titles and advance to the MEAC Tournament championship round in both seasons. Beard was a first-team All-MEAC outfielder as a senior in 2017, when he batted .332 with 13 doubles and four triples. He also pitched 30.1 innings over 13 appearances in his NSU career, notching two saves as a senior.
Beard was also a standout in the classroom at Norfolk State. He earned first-team academic all-district and second-team academic All-America honors from CoSIDA as a senior, the first player in NSU baseball history to do so. He was also a member of the NSU Athletics Director’s Honor Roll and MEAC All-Academic Team. Beard earned a bachelor’s degree in business management from NSU in 2017.
A Chesapeake native, Beard graduated from Great Bridge High School, where he was an all-district baseball and football player.
